Chester Grosvenor's Michelin omission leaves the county with no stars

When Paul Bocuse's flagship Lyon restaurant misplaced its Three Michelin Star ranking, the culinary world was aghast. May requirements have slipped in one of many world's greatest eating places?

Michelin mentioned that whereas the restaurant "remained wonderful", it was not on the degree of three stars.

The workforce on the now two-star institution on the River Soane launched a press release saying: "Though upset by the inspectors' judgement, there may be one factor that we by no means need to lose, it's the soul of Mr. Paul. Paul Bocuse was a visionary, a free man, a pressure of nature."

However a really totally different story is that of the Chester Grosvenor, who've misplaced their one-star accolade on account of the restaurant being closed for thus lengthy that they weren't eligible. They have been one of many longest standing holders of a Michelin star within the UK, having been awarded it in 1990.

Because the workforce in Cheshire depart the county with no Michelin stars in any respect, famend London restaurant Le Gavroche continues to guide the pack with an unprecedented Michelin longevity of 47 years.

Opening in 1967 they have been the primary UK institution to achieve one star (1973), which turned two quickly after (1977), after which hit the dizzy heights of three in 1982.

It misplaced its third star in 1993 however continues to hold two stars to the current day.

Internationally, you would need to return to Bocuse for the file. It held three stars for 55 years.

The workforce on the Grosvenor says they look ahead to launching their new refined eating idea in Spring 2022, which has been rebranded as Arkle.
